
Equipment
- oven and stove
Ingredients
- 16 oz high protein super firm tofu, crumbled
- 2 tbsp tomato paste
- ½ cup buffalo sauce
- 1 tbsp maple syrup
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1 tsp cumin
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p onion powder
- 2 tbsp nutritional yeast
- 12 mini street taco tortillas, corn or almond flour
- ½ cup dairy-free shredded cheese, optional
- 1 cup plain, unsweetened dairy-free yogurt
- 2 limes, juiced
- ½ bunch cilantro
- ½ - 1 jalapeño, seeds removed (adjust for desired spice)
- 1 garlic clove
- 1 tbsp maple syrup
- pinch of salt
Method
- Preheat oven to 425 and line a large metal ba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add a splash of cooking oil or water to coat.
- Add in the crumbled tofu and cook for about 10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until golden and crispy. Remove and set aside.
- Add the tomato paste, buffalo sauce, maple syrup, spices, and nutritional yeast; stir to coat and season to taste with salt and pepper (I did not need to use either).
- Fill each tortilla with a layer of filling and add a sprinkle of cheese if desired. Fold in half and place on the baking sheet, being sure not to overcrowd.
- Bake for 16-20 minutes, flipping halfway through, until golden and crisp.
- While tacos are baking, prepare the sauce by adding all ingredients to a blender and pureeing until smooth and creamy. Season to taste.
- Serve tacos hot with sauce for dipping.

Loved this recipe! Tasted great and not overly complicated. Taste test your buffalo sauce ahead of time to make sure it’s not too spicy. I used less buffalo sauce and added some plant based yogurt to tame it down since what I had was very spicy. In addition, pay attention to how much lime juice you get from 2 limes when making the cilantro lime dipping sauce. My limes were very juicy and the sauce ended up being way too thin but tasted great. I chopped some avocado and tomatoes to serve on top. I served this with Mexican brown rice and black beans.
